Phil Collins To Release 3 Disc Set Of All His Solo Singles

by Music-News.com on July 13, 2016

in New Music,News

Phil Collins has spent much of the year repackaging his solo albums in new deluxe editions and, on October 14, he will release a brand new three-CD retrospective collecting almost every one of his singles from 1981 to 2010.

Appropriately titled The Singles, the set has forty-five tracks, presented in chronological order from his solo debut, In the Air Tonight to Going Back, the last single from his final album of the same name.

Not everything here was a hit. You sometimes can’t separate the Collins solo hits from those he had with Genesis during the 80’s as it seems every fifth song on the radio was by one or the other, but twenty of the forty-five never charted in the U.S. and only fourteen made it to the U.S. top ten. Half of those fourteen went to number 1.

There is only one track that keeps this from being a complete collection. While Collins released forty five singles and there are forty five tracks, the album includes the 2003 double sided The Least You Can Do/Wake Up Call from Testify but leaves off the previous single, Come With Me. Still, just a slight oversight in an otherwise complete set.

Of note are the numerous songs that were not on any of Collins’ solo albums that were originally released on the soundtracks for Against All Odds, White Nights, Buster, Tarzan and Brother Bear plus Easy Lover that originally came from Philip Bailey’s Chinese Wall.

The Singles will also be released in a two-CD set with 33 tracks and a four-LP vinyl version along with digital.

The track list with original album and U.S. and U.K. chart information for the 3-CD set:

Disc One

Face Value
In The Air Tonight (1981 / #19 U.S. / #2 U.K.)
I Missed Again (1981 / #19 U.S. / #14 U.K.)
If Leaving Me Is Easy (1981 / #17 U.K.)

Hello, I Must Be Going
Thru These Walls (1982 / #56 U.K.)
You Can’t Hurry Love (1982 / #10 U.S. / #1 U.K.)
I Don’t Care Anymore (1983 / #39 U.S.)
Don’t Let Him Steal Your Heart Away (1983 / #45 U.K.)
Why Can’t It Wait ‘Til Morning (1983 / #89 U.K.)
I Cannot Believe It’s True (1983 / #79 U.S.)

Against All Odds Soundtrack
Against All Odds (Take A Look At Me Now) (1984 / #1 U.S. / #2 U.K.)

Philip Bailey’s Chinese Walls
Easy Lover (with Philip Bailey) (1985 / #2 U.S. / #1 U.K.)

No Jacket Required
Sussudio (1985 / #1 U.S. / #12 U.K.)
One More Night (1985 / #1 U.S. / #4 U.K.)
Don’t Lose My Number (1985 / #4 U.S.)
Take Me Home (1985 / #7 U.S. / #19 U.K.)

Disc Two

White Nights Soundtrack
Separate Lives (with Marilyn Martin) (1985 / #1 U.S. / #4 U.K.)

Buster Soundtrack
A Groovy Kind Of Love (1988 / #1 U.S. / #1 U.K.)
Two Hearts (1988 / #1 U.S. / #6 U.K.)

…But Seriously
Another Day In Paradise (1989 / #1 U.S. / #2 U.K.)
I Wish It Would Rain Down (1990 / #3 U.S. / #7 U.K.)
Something Happened On The Way To Heaven (1990 / #4 U.S. / #15 U.K.)
That’s Just The Way It Is (1990 / #26 U.K.)
Hang In Long Enough (1990 / #23 U.S. / #34 U.K.)

Serious Hits…Live
Do You Remember? (1990 / #4 U.S. / #57 U.K.)
Who Said I Would (1991 / #73 U.S.)

Both Sides
Both Sides Of The Story (1993 / #25 U.S. / #7 U.K.)
Everyday (1994 / #24 U.S. / #15 U.K.)
We Wait And We Wonder (1994 / #45 U.K.)

Dance Into the Light
Dance Into The Light (1996 / #45 U.S. / #9 U.K.)
It’s In Your Eyes (1996 / #77 U.S. / #30 U.K.)

Disc Three

Dance Into the Light
No Matter Who (1997 / Did not chart)
Wear My Hat (1997 / #43 U.K.)
The Same Moon (1997 / Did not chart)

…Hits
True Colors (1998 / #26 U.K.)

Tarzan Soundtrack
You’ll Be In My Heart (1999 / #21 U.S. / #17 U.K.)
Strangers Like Me (2000 / Did not chart)
Son Of Man (2000 / Did not chart)
Two Worlds (2000 / Did not chart)

Testify
Can’t Stop Loving You (2002 / #76 U.S. / #28 U.K.)
The Least You Can Do (2003 / #86 U.K.)
Wake Up Call (2003 / #86 U.K.)

Buster Soundtrack
Look Through My Eyes (2003 / #61 U.K.)
No Way Out (2004 / Did not chart)

Going Back
(Love Is Like A) Heatwave (2010 / Did not chart)
Going Back (2010 / Did not chart)
